What companies run services between O2 Arena, Czechia and Prague Airport (PRG), Czechia?

There is no direct connection from O2 Arena to Prague Airport (PRG). However, you can walk to Českomoravská, take the subway to Můstek, take the subway to Nádraží Veleslavín, walk to Nádraží Veleslavín, then take the line 59 train to Václav Havel Airport T1.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from O2 Arena to Václav Havel Airport T1 via Českomoravská, Florenc, and Praha, Hlavní Nádraží in around 1h 10m.
